Ruth Cooper Morgan

August 16, 1923 — December 6, 2009

Ruth Cooper Morgan, 86, of Jonesboro, passed away Sunday, December 6, 2009 at her home. Ruth was born August 16, 1923 in Melbourne, Arkansas to Alvie & Annie Belle Cooper.

She was preceded in death by her parents and three brothers, Remel, Carl, and Charles Cooper; and one sister, Verl Rodden.

Survivors are her husband, Samuel F. Morgan, of the home; one sister, Bernice Ward of St. Charles, Missouri; and one brother, Paul Cooper of Jefferson City, Missouri.

She married Samuel Morgan in Piggott, Arkansas on May 26, 1948. She was a graduate of Greenway High School and Cosmetology School in Cape Girardeau, Missouri. She worked in a small arms factory in St. Louis, Missouri as an inspector during World War II. She was a member of Normandy Road Baptist Church in Royal Oak, Michigan. She resided in Clawson, Michigan until retiring in Jonesboro in 1987. Ruth was a faithful fan of the Roundup at Brookland.

Graveside services will be held Tuesday at 3:00 p.m. at Piggott Cemetery with Jerry Morgan officiating. Emerson Funeral Home is in charge of arrangements.

Visitation will be Tuesday from 1:30 – 2:30 p.m. at Hoggard & Sons Funeral Home in Piggott.

The family requests that memorials be made to the Alzheimer’s Association or to the Susan G. Komen Headquarters.
